Default art schools in chicago

hello, i will most likely be moving to chicago soon and am looking to take some continuing ed art classes. i've found columbia and the art institute of chicago. anyone know how these two compare or of any other schools?

Really depends what sort of "art" you are talking about. The School of the Art Institute is a pretty high-powered lofty place for many disciplines, but when it comes to film and some other specialties Columbia has some strengths. Very different depending on what your goals/needs are...
